The Canton Police Department and FBI agents arrested a suspect in connection with a Huntington Bank robbery last month inside the Giant Eagle store on Raff Road SW at West Tuscarawas Street.

Andrew Fisher, 34, of Canton, was arrested Wednesday and charged with aggravated robbery for the robbery that occurred in the afternoon of Feb. 1.

It’s alleged that Fisher walked into the Giant Eagle location and to the Huntington Bank branch inside the grocery story. He was wearing a black ski mask and a blue jacket when he approached the teller and handed her a note demanding cash.

The suspect received an undisclosed amount of cash and left the building in an unknown direction.

Fisher also faces a couple of felony drug charges.

He was picked up without incident Wednesday at a home in the 1500 block of 30th Street NW.
